Farm Loan Interest Rates
Farm loan interest rates experienced an increase in Q3 and Q4 of 2022. Despite this, farmland values are stronger than ever. Due to strong commodity prices, demand for farmland increased. Cash rents also increased, and farm net income gains remained strong.
These underlying farmland valuation increases continue to keep the ag economy strong for landowners.
Those looking to purchase land in 2023 may face rising interest rates, as well as having to contend with historic inflation and a competitive market. For many, purchasing a farm is becoming prohibitively expensive.
In this environment, would-be landowners must take advantage of every available resource and do their research to ensure they not only find the right property, but the right interest rate.
Having a competitive interest rate may seem like the most important aspect of a loan, but buyers also need to consider the structure of their debt. It is important to work closely with a lender that understands the ag lending space. An ag lender will better understand the specific needs and overhead farmers have.
